Tera Kya Hoga Johnny (Hindi: तेरा क्या होगा जॉनी; English: What's gonna happen to you, Johnny) is a 2008 Bollywood movie directed by critically acclaimed director Sudhir Mishra, starring child actor Sikander in the lead role. Actors Neil Mukesh, Kay Kay Menon, Soha Ali Khan and Karan Nath are also part of the movie. It also stars two filmmakers Anurag Kashyap and Aditya Bhattacharya.
The movie is about the city of Mumbai, and a child who sells tea on its streets. In the words of the director, "It's set at a time when Mumbai wants to be Shanghai." He has also stated that he wants to make a sequel to the movie. [2]
In January 2010, the film was leaked on YouTube while still undergoing post-production work. Mishra filed an FIR and the police are investigating the source of the leak.[3]

The film’s main protagonist, Johnny played by Sikander Agarwal is a tea boy on the streets of Mumbai, who dreams of having a better life in Dubai. Johnny’s hopes of making it in life are pinned on the fortunes of three people he admires – Parvez, Preeti and Vishal. Neil plays Parvez, a Muslim from Ahmedabad who wants to get rich quick so that he can fulfill his responsibilities and reclaim his love(Shahana Goswami), who is now married to a corrupt cop, (Kay Kay Menon). Preeti (Soha Ali Khan) is a small time model and Vishal (Karan Nath) is her drug addict boy friend.
In last days of Jan, 2010 the film faced controversy when a major chunk of the film was released online in 5-6 parts over the online video sharing website, www.youtube.com. It may be known that the film has bee complete for close to 2 years now and has been doing the rounds of international film festivals and was to be released this year. When asked an official for producers said “We have filed a complaint at the cyber crime police station at the Bandra Kurla cyber crime department and we will file one at Juhu police station. We have also written to youtube.com and asked them to remove the footages as it is the most easily accessible website. We have formally made a complaint to them as well. The complaint at the Juhu Police station is at the second stage of investigation in which the culprit will be booked. However, what has been uploaded is not the finished project and is the older cut of the film.” ‘Tera Kya Hogga Johnny’ has been made for Rs 12-crore. Producer Manu Kumaran said, “I was informed by one of our crew member Pankaj Sharma about this. We have made all the notified complaints and also spoken to all our suppliers who were working on the post-production of the film. However, we are to blame as it is also a system failure from our side. We need to be more careful.”
